I am new to these forums -- I am an exploring options in replacing the Parker-installed fixed pedestals, especially because of the high seat height in relation to the console on a new 2310 Parker WA. Springfield Marine manufactures an adjustable (up to 36") pedestal and this morning I learned about Seaspension in these Parker owner forums. Garelick and Atwood(?) don't seem to make fixed or adjustable pedestals that will get me the right height. Are there other adjustable pedestal manufacturers I'm missing? Thanks for your guidance.
 
I would suggest using the seat as is for a while once you receive the boat, you may get use to it and like it the way it is. If you still want to lower it just remove the seat and cut the pedestal down
